Will Sunderland heap more misery on Moyes and Man United?
David Moyes has gone from having the best start of any United manager post Sir Matt Busby, to having the worst Premier League start of any United manager in a matter of days. Whilst the midweek performance against Shakhtar should ease some nerves, the fact is that Moyes is still struggling to find his first XI and Sunderland might yet prove tricky opponents.
On the face of it, it looks barely possible. After all, United are unbeaten in their last 19 games against the Black Cats and look firm favorites to inflict more misery on a listless start to Sunderland’s season. But, lets not forget, the same was said of West Brom last weekend and look what they managed to do. So, Moyes will surely have his task cut out for him, and defeat against Sunderland will heap even more pressure on himself, which he could very well do without.
